With TreenessEmerging we explore Iterated Function Systems (IFS) in three variations: the Chaos Game, the Deterministic Iteration, and Random Iteration.

When the Chaos Game window is topmost, we are presented with
* a Run/Stop button,
* a Continue button,
* a Reset button,
* a Scaling scroll bar,
* a Speed scroll bar,
* a Draw Lines check box,
* a Draw Vertices check box, and
* Active Window - the large window on the right half of the screen.

* The corners of the Chaos Game are selected by moving the mouse pointer to the desired point in the Active Window.

* Note the pixel coordinates of the pointer are displayed in a pop up window above the Active Window.

* Clicking the mouse button selects the point as a corner of the chaos game.

* Holding the shift key while clicking the mouse button makes the selected point the starting point of the of the Chaos Game.

* Clicking the Start button begins the Chaos Game. When this is done, the Run Button label changes to Stop.

* The game can be interrupted by clicking the Stop button, and resumed by clicking the Continue button.

* Clicking Stop, then Reset, erases the corners selected and lets us select new corners.

* When Draw Lines is checked, the lines of the Chaos Game are drawn; when Draw Lines is not checked, the lines are erased (though the points generated by the Chaos Game remain in the window).

* When Draw Vertices is checked, the vertices of the Chaos Game are drawn; when Draw Vertices is not checked, the vertices are erased (though the points generated by the Chaos Game remain in the window). By a vertex we mean a point generated by the Chaos Game, but drawn as a small circle for emphasis.

* The Speed scroll bar adjusts the speed with which the Chaos Game is played.

* The Scaling scroll bar the fraction of the distance along a line at which the new point (vertex) is drawn.

Note:

* While the Chaos Game is running, clicking the pointer inside the drawing window adds that point to the list of corners - the game continues with that corner included with the earlier corners.

* The scaling and speed can be changed while the Chaos Game is running, the game continuing with the changed values.

* To display cycles, draw the picture by clicking the Run button, then stop the drawing by clicking the Stop button. (To best see the cycle, don't let the drawing of the picture fill in too darkly.) Click the cycle entries (top to bottom), changing 0 to 1, 2, ..., n ( = number of transformations), pressing the Return key after entering each cycle number. Click the Cycle checkbox and the Continue button to display the cycle. After stopping, clicking again the Cycle checkbox (removing the check) erases the cycle points.

* To display a region of given address, draw the fractal by clicking the Run button, then stop the drawing by clicking the Stop button. (To best see the region, don't let the drawing of the picture fill in too darkly.) Click the address digits (top to bottom), changing 0 to 1, 2, ..., n ( = number of transformations). Click the Address checkbox and the Continue button the display the region. After stopping, clicking again the Address checkbox (removing the check) erases the address points highlighting the region. Clicking the ClearAddr button removes the dots illustrating the region of given address.

When the Parameters window is topmost we are presented with a table of seven columns and fourteen rows. The columns are for the rule parameters R, S, Theta, Phi, E, F, and Probability. Entries in the table can be changed by darkening them (dragging the cursor across with the mouse or double clicking in the box) and then typing the new number and pressing Return afterward.
